I have included my screen shots, registry edits and the different device information for you to plow through and compare. Now, remember this is for the AT&T Raphael pocket pc phone.
Steps
1. Install SRS_WOW_HD 121.CAB and reboot the ppc
2. Install WOWHD_ARM_Panel.cpl
3. Change the registry entries before going into the app.
4. Goto: [H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\Drivers\BuiltIn\WaveDev]
5. Change "Flags"=dword:00010000 to "Flags"=dword:00010002
6. Launch SRS WOW from the settings and use the screen shot I supplied. I like the heavey bass thumping sound, so these are my settings.
SRS Software Versions
I could not get the other software versions to work with the raphael phone. So for SRS to work 121 is the only one that works. Don't waste your time trying the others....just use 121
Now, how do you figure out if your Raphael phone will produce the sound with SRS WOW as I mentioned above? That is a good question because it definitely comes down to the electronics in the device that HTC puts into the device. Should SRS WOW work on all devices "YES" but as I expressed earlier, it does not. I have already been through four phones and two worked and two didn't. (Same settings, reg edits, radio, spl etc). So there is something between the devices that delivers better performance with SRS.
Stats Information on PPC
Rom Version ROMeOS v1.51 WWE
Rom Date: 12/04/08
Radio Version: 1.02.25.32
Protocol Version: 52.39c.25.22U
IMEI - first ten digits I noticed a trend between phones. "15" works and "12" does not. I verified this with the other two phones and the one that did work also had a "15"..
3531420212 SRS doesn't work (Old Phone)
3531420215 SRS works (New Phone)
